Matte Lamination — The Understated Luxury Finish That Commands Premium Perception

Matte lamination is the finish of choice for brands that understand luxury is communicated through restraint. The non-reflective matte film eliminates glare and surface sheen, creating a quiet, sophisticated visual presence that consumers instinctively associate with higher quality and higher price points. In a retail environment full of glossy, aggressive packaging, a matte-finished box communicates confidence — it does not need to shout to be noticed.

The matte film also creates a distinctive tactile quality — slightly toothy, almost velvety — that enhances the sensory experience of handling the package. Consumers who pick up a matte-finished box hold it longer, which correlates directly with higher purchase rates. The combination of visual and tactile premium signals makes matte lamination one of the highest-ROI finishing investments in premium packaging.

Matte as the Base for Spot UV Contrast

Matte lamination is most dramatically effective as the base for spot UV contrast finishing. The matte surface creates a perfectly non-reflective background; the glossy spot UV applied to selected design elements creates a dramatic contrast between the two surface states. Logos, product names, and key design elements treated with spot UV on a matte background appear to glow with reflected light — a visual sophistication that neither finish alone can achieve.

Does matte lamination affect color appearance?

Yes. Matte lamination slightly reduces the apparent saturation and contrast of printed colors compared to gloss lamination — a natural consequence of the light-scattering surface that eliminates specular reflection. This reduction in brightness is generally perceived as more sophisticated for premium brands, though brands with critical color requirements should proof on matte substrates before committing.

Is matte lamination more expensive than gloss?

Matte lamination film costs marginally more than standard gloss film, but the difference in finished box cost is typically less than 3-5%. The brand value created by matte lamination far exceeds this modest cost difference for most premium packaging applications.

Can matte and gloss be combined on the same box?

Yes. Selective application of matte and gloss finishes — matte overall with gloss UV on specific elements — is one of the most popular premium finishing combinations. It creates visual contrast and tactile interest that communicates significant investment in quality.

Is matte lamination durable enough for retail packaging?

Yes. Matte lamination provides the same level of scratch, moisture, and handling protection as gloss lamination. The matte surface is slightly more prone to showing fingerprints on very dark backgrounds, which is the primary functional trade-off versus gloss.

What is the difference between matte lamination and satin coating?

Matte lamination is a plastic film bonded to the surface — more durable and moisture-resistant. Satin coating is an aqueous or UV-cured coating applied as a liquid — more eco-friendly but less protective. For packaging requiring robust protection, matte lamination is preferred.
